The jackpot is seeded by
taking 50 cents from every
pot on the specially labeled
ring game tables. As soon as
a player has a monster hand
cracked, the jackpot will be
won, with every active
player at the table
receiving a portion of the
prize money! The player with
the losing hand will pick up
the biggest percentage, so
if you have four sevens or
better using both hole
cards, you should definitely
hope to get beat!
Bad Beat Jackpot
requirements:
|
• |
The
losing hand must be
at least a Four of a
Kind 7's |
|
• |
The
winning hand must be
at least a Four of a
Kind 8's |
|
• |
Both the winning and
losing hands must
include both hole
cards. |
|
• |
At
least four players
must be dealt in at
the start of the
hand |
|
• |
The
hand must have
generated jackpot
rake (ie. $0.50)
|
|
• |
Two
or more players must
be active at the end
of the hand, and it
must go to showdown.
|
|
• |
BetonUSA does not
tolerate collusion.
All players must act
independently and
not reveal their
hands to other
players, nor tell
them how to act.
Failure to adhere to
this requirement
will result in
automatic
disqualification
from the Bad Beat
Jackpot. |
|
• |
Players sitting out
at the Bad Beat
Jackpot tables are
not eligible for the
Bad Beat Jackpot.
|
|
• |
Should two
qualifying jackpot
hands hit at
precisely the same
time, the jackpot
will be awarded to
the hand that began
first according to
BetonUSA's server
time. The second of
the qualifying bad
beat hands would be
eligible for the
reseeded Bad Beat
Jackpot. |
|
• |
If
there are two or
more hands that
qualify for the
jackpot within one
hand, then the two
highest hands will
be considered for
the jackpot, with
the highest hand
being the winning
hand and the second
highest hand winning
the bad beat. |

Bad Beat Payout
Structure
| • |
35%
to the Loser |
| • |
20%
to Reseeding the
Jackpot |
| • |
17.5%
to the Winner |
| • |
17.5%
to Other Players
(must be dealt into
the hand - not
sitting out) |
| • |
10%
to the poker network
for administration
fees |
